summaryrefslogtreecommitdiff
path: root/pxelinux.asm
diff options
context:
space:
mode:
authorhpa <hpa>2001-04-09 00:30:20 +0000
committerhpa <hpa>2001-04-09 00:30:20 +0000
commit85c2cba80b929363897b464d9f0bc46d0072428a (patch)
treedee546d163b7d79c11ffb4565db770484557acf0 /pxelinux.asm
parentfea7d196e7d3745cf4d954c77fa3e3a3cc93c854 (diff)
downloadsyslinux-85c2cba80b929363897b464d9f0bc46d0072428a.tar.gz
Call vgaclearmode before doing a local boot.
Diffstat (limited to 'pxelinux.asm')
-rw-r--r--pxelinux.asm1
1 files changed, 1 insertions, 0 deletions
diff --git a/pxelinux.asm b/pxelinux.asm
index 2a357c1c..750c3bd9 100644
--- a/pxelinux.asm
+++ b/pxelinux.asm
@@ -2140,6 +2140,7 @@ is_bss_sector:
; AX contains the appropriate return code.
;
local_boot:
+ call vgaclearmode
lss sp,[cs:Stack] ; Restore stack pointer
pop ds ; Restore DS
mov [LocalBootType],ax